Broome County Government, many local school districts and several local municipalities have saved over $250,000 in energy costs thanks to a unique energy purchasing alliance.
Broome County has been a sponsoring government and partner with the Municipal Electric and Gas Alliance (M.E.G.A.) since June 2001. M.E.G.A. is a not-for-profit local development corporation with 6 counties as principal members, these members include; Broome, Cortland, Otsego, Schuyler, Tioga and Tompkins counties. The alliance pools it's electric needs and purchases electricity from the lowest bidder. Growing membership in the alliance allows for a greater group purchase resulting in lower energy costs. There is no fee to join the alliance and members pay only for the energy they use. . .
